Use drugs with caution

Drugs that have been proven to affect the embryo include anti-epileptic drugs, certain psychiatric drugs, certain special types of antibiotics, etc. These drugs have been proven to have a direct impact on the embryo, and although the effects of other drugs are not obvious, they should still be used with caution.
